León XIV and Bad Bunny, a coincidence in Madrid that leaves the door open to a meeting

 

In parallel to the Pontiff’s agenda, which combines institutional meetings, religious and social events in various parts of the capital, highlights are the two concerts that Bad Bunny will offer on Saturday and Sunday at the Metropolitano, where he has already held a total of four concerts on his ‘I should throw more photos’ tour.

The coincidence of both events has unleashed speculation about a possible meeting between Leo XIV and the singer. The Archbishop of Madrid, José Cobo, did not rule out in an interview with Europa Press that the meeting could take place and appealed to build “bridges.”

“Madrid gives a lot. But they are, there are people – and I don’t know that, history will tell when the Pope goes, what happens, not me, what the people decide, what the Pope decides, what Bad Bunny decides -, who do not oppose, but create bridges and it could be, there could be bridges. They would not be antagonistic things,” he specified.

Cobo admitted that the Archdiocese of Madrid is “willing to collaborate”, but insisted that “surprises are surprises” and that these types of meetings “are carried out very secretly.”

RIGOBERTA BANDINI: ‘SOLD OUT’ DESPITE COINCIDING WITH THE POPE AND BAD BUNNY

This weekend’s musical program is completed with a new edition of the Botánico Nights concert series, which will host the third concert of the Spanish artist Rigoberta Bandini at this festival on Saturday, June 6.

The artist has hung up the ‘no tickets’ sign after selling nearly 4,000 tickets each of the three nights she is going to perform, including the day her show coincides with the Pope’s Vigil and the Bad Bunny concert, as sources from the Noches del Botánico Festival have confirmed to Europa Press. Meanwhile, on Sunday the 7th it will be the turn of the Irish group Two Door Cinema Club.

BOOK FAIR

The literary agenda also takes center stage with the celebration of the Madrid Book Fair, which continues this weekend with a program focused on European cultural debate, contemporary literature and the role of new voices.

Booksellers and publishers present at the Book Fair have already made clear their “relative concern” for the second weekend of the literary event. This was the case of the writer and bookseller Marina Sanmartón, head of the Cervantes Bookstore, who, in statements to Europa Press, admitted her concern.

For her part, the director of the Fair, Eva Orúe, reiterated her words from a few weeks ago, explaining that the Pontiff’s visit “evidently” will have an impact. “It is evident that it is going to affect us, in a way that bringing 1 million or 1.5 million people could not. We have not changed the programming, we have not changed anything about that day the 7th because we trust that, even if it is a little more difficult to get there, we will arrive. What we are already doing is a call to the exhibitors, the participants in activities and the public to leave home a little earlier and even if they arrive later, to not stop coming,” explained Orúe.

FILM PARTY

The cultural agenda is completed with the beginning on Monday the 8th of the Film Festival, which will be held throughout Spain until Thursday the 11th. More than 336 cinemas throughout Spain participate in this initiative that will especially affect Madrid and Catalonia, according to the Federation of Cinemas of Spain (FECE).

‘WHITE (AND YELLOW) NIGHT’

In parallel, the cultural initiative ‘Night in White (and Yellow) will be held, to which several entities and museums have joined, opening their doors with extended hours and with free access on the night of Saturday, June 6 to Sunday, June 7.

Thus, the Reina Sofía Museum will open its doors free of charge from 7:00 p.m. to 11:30 p.m., while the Thyssen Museum will be open until 12:00 a.m. The Prado will also celebrate its ‘El Prado at night’ initiative from 8:30 p.m. to 12:30 a.m.

The Royal Collections Gallery, the Royal Academy of Fine Arts of San Fernando and the Naval Museum also participate in this ‘Night in White (and Yellow) initiative; cultural and artistic centers such as CaixaForum, Espacio Fundación Telefónica, Fundación Mapfre; local museums such as the Madrid History Museum, the Debod Temple or the San Isidro Museum; or entities, both public and private, such as the Canal Theaters or the Banca March Garden.
